Tucked in Medellin, Adelaida Pensionne Hotel has quietly become one of the more interesting budget hotel options in Medellin. Geographically speaking it's in a quieter stretch of the city, well outside the tourist crush, and the modest location rating in guest reviews backs that up. Rooms feel modest; the touches travellers mention most are reliable wi-fi and on-site parking, and the comfort feedback has been uneven. The numbers behind the reviews tell their own story, around 200 reviews, scoring solid on balance. The reputation reads as steady rather than spiking. Recent rates have been hovering around €20 a night, which lands as a fair-value option for the city. The honest read on Adelaida Pensionne Hotel is that it deserves a side-by-side look against the bigger Medellin names rather than a headline of its own.
